Unexploded device discovered in Solihull prompts evacuations and road closures

AN UNEXPLODED device discovered in Solihull today has prompted evacuations and road closures.

West Midlands Police said this afternoon (April 9): “Officers have cordoned off an area around Streetsbrook Road in Shirley, Solihull, after a suspected unexploded device was discovered in a garden.

“Some nearby homes have been evacuated as a precaution and we are advising motorists that roads are closed in the surrounding area.”
